Unveiling Kyōyū: the New Seasonal Restaurant on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a’s Sky Terrace

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a is pleased to announce the launch of its new pop-up restaurant concept, Kyōyū. The name, meaning “sharing” in Japanese symbolises an innovative concept that unites Japanese cuisine with Latin American influences. Situated on the expansive Sky Terrace offering panoramic views of historic Bern, Kyōyū provides the perfect setting to unwind and enjoy sunny days in a relaxed atmosphere.

A Circle Closes: Yamato and Kyōyū at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a

Kyōyū makes its debut over three and a half decades after the opening of Restaurant Yamato, Switzerland's first Japanese hotel restaurant, which first welcomed guests at Schweizerhof in 1987. Founded by owner

Jean-Jacques Gauer upon his return from a trip and established with the assistance of then-hotel manager Benjamin Güller, Yamato introduced the flavours of Japanese cuisine to the capital city.

On the Food and Drink Menu

In tune with the warmer temperatures, Kyōyū offers a summer-inspired menu featuring light dishes such as sea bass ceviche, assorted tacos, daily special rolls, and tiradito with seared salmon. Dessert options also extend to include treats such as mochis and tres leches in an assortment of flavours. The decor, with its pastel hues and minimalist design, creates a serene atmosphere ideal for gatherings with family, friends, and loved ones.

Beyond its culinary offerings, Kyōyū features an array of signature cocktails, complemented by a curated selection of sake, Japanese beer, and wine. Noteworthy among these is the "Tea Ceremony," combining yuzu vermouth, lemon, jasmine, and green tea for a refreshing and memorable flavour profile.

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a

The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a is part of the Bürgenstock Collection headquartered in Switzerland. The house offers 99 rooms and suites, an 800 m2 conference centre with 11 halls and rooms, including the legendary “Trianon” ballroom, the Jack’s Brasserie restaurant, the lobby-lounge-bar, a cigar lounge, a 500 m² spa and an unparalleled sky terrace. The company portfolio includes the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a, the Royal Savoy Hotel & Spa Lausanne (196 rooms), the Bürgenstock Resort Lake Lucerne (348 rooms) and The Adria in South Kensington, London (24 rooms).

The Bürgenstock Collection

The Bürgenstock Collection is one of Switzerland’s largest deluxe hotel groups, operating Hotels and Residences with a combined total of 667 rooms and 67 residence suites. The Bürgenstock Resort Lake Lucerne (348 rooms), the Hotel Schweizerhof Bern & Spa (99 rooms), the Royal Savoy Hotel & Spa Lausanne (196 rooms) and The Adria in South Kensington, London (24 rooms) dazzle guests from all over the world with their rich heritage, elegant, contemporary design, leading spas and their exceptional culinary offers, while remaining completely true to the timeless Swiss traditions of hospitality, service and discretion.

About Katara Hospitality

Katara Hospitality is a global hotel owner, developer, and operator, based in Qatar. With 50 years’ experience in the industry, Katara Hospitality actively pursues its strategic expansion plans by investing in peerless hotels in Qatar while growing its collection of iconic properties in key international markets. Katara Hospitality’s portfolio has grown to include 42 owned and / or managed hotels and the company is now focused on achieving its target of 60 hotels in its portfolio by 2030. As the country’s flagship hospitality organisation, Katara Hospitality supports Qatar’s long-term economic vision.

Katara Hospitality currently owns properties spread across four continents in Qatar, Egypt, Morocco, UK, France, Italy, Spain, Switzerland, The Netherlands, Singapore, Thailand and United States of America. While it partners with some of the finest hotel management companies, Katara Hospitality operates owned and non-owned hotels through its standalone operating arm, The Bürgenstock Collection and Murwab Hotel Group.
